With new regulations imminent, drivers have just two more races with the current Formula 1 car generation. Max Verstappen, along with Fernando Alonso and George Russell, expressed in Las Vegas that they will not miss the existing cars. They criticized the ground-effect vehicles for being heavy, large, and cumbersome, particularly struggling with slow corners. This sentiment highlights a broader dissatisfaction with the current design and performance of the cars.
